PHILADELPHIA,PA — City Council has voted in the affirmative on Councilmember Isaiah Thomas’ Keep It Local Bill; this bill would require local business usage and raise reporting requirements in the City of Philadelphia’s procurement process. He wanted to make sure I had a job and I oc When I was a freshman at Frankford High School in Philadelphia, my dad signed me up for the Freedom Schools summer program. Eventually my work in the Freedom Schools program would meet the world of politics when Tom Corbett was elected Governor of Pennsylvania and funding was cut for education. This had a huge impact on the Freedom Schools movement as our funding was cut and more than half the sites were forced to close. PhillyCAM Video Voter Guide Video. YES [ X ] NO [ ]. Through my work with the Freedom Schools movement I developed a relationship with the local state representatives and eventually took a position working part time where I was inspired to run for city council at large.
